Two men arrested after cops find £135k heroin in Shetland

Two men are due to appear in court following a £135,000 heroin discovery in Shetland.

Officers approached a van in the Sandveien area of Lerwick around 12:45pm on Monday 24 May.

Heroin worth a six-figure street value was seized nearby.

The two men, aged 46 and 47, have been arrested and charged and will appear at Lerwick Sheriff Court in connection to the recovery.

Detective Sergeant Bruce Peebles of Lerwick CID said: “This was a significant recovery of Class A drugs, especially for Shetland.

“I want to assure people that we are committed to tackling the sale and supply of drugs in our communities.”
